Watch The Bachelor in Paradise on YouTube TV

youtube tv

YouTube TV is another great option to watch The Bachelor in Paradise live. YouTube TV offers live ABC with its streaming service in nearly ALL markets in the US. The only market where YouTube TV doesn’t offer ABC is the Rochester-Mason City-Austin market, which covers parts of Minnesota and Iowa. (YouTube TV does offer ABC in Rochester, NY and Austin, TX.)

YouTube TV supports Roku, Android, iOS, Apple TV, Fire TV, Chromecast, and more. Be sure to check out our review of YouTube TV for more information. You can sign up for their free trial.

How Much: $72.99 per month.

About The Bachelor in Paradise

The Bachelor in Paradise brings together former contenders from The Bachelor and The Bachelorette at an intimate, isolated location to explore new relationships and a second chance at love. This time, the sexy singles will be passing time in a romantic Mexican locale.
